introduction: this article discusses "reasons and market prospects for investing in aircraft rooms in thailand". in this article, "aircraft rooms" refer to aircraft-themed accommodation or special accommodations converted from retired aircraft, as well as properties with special location attributes around the airport, and its investment logic and feasibility are analyzed.
thailand has long been an important tourist destination in asia, with frequent international and regional flights, and airport passenger flow driving demand for accommodation and transportation. for well-positioned aircraft rooms or airport surrounding properties, a stable passenger base can provide long-term customer sources, thus supporting the sustainability of leasing and short-term rental businesses.
airplane rooms attract tourists with their experience and topicality, and are easy to spread on short-term rental platforms and social media. compared with traditional hotels, they are differentiated products and can maintain a premium through distinctive positioning in the off-season, but the quality of the experience needs to be continuously maintained.
investment in aircraft rooms can be combined with diversified income models such as short-term rentals, themed b&bs and long-term rentals. short-term rentals rely on platform exposure and operational capabilities, while long-term rentals provide cash flow stability. flexible operating strategies can help improve overall returns and spread cyclical risks.
overseas investment in thai real estate involves property rights forms and regulatory compliance. foreign buyers often hold properties through leases, corporate structures or restricted property rights. before investing, you should consult local lawyers and tax advisors to clarify the ownership structure, lease term and licensing requirements to avoid legal risks.
with the recovery of tourism, consumption upgrading and the popularity of specialty accommodation, there is room for growth in aircraft rooms with differentiated experiences. however, you need to be wary of uncertainties such as regulatory changes, the impact of aviation noise, seasonal fluctuations and self-operated operating costs, and evaluate before entering.
it is recommended to conduct market research and feasibility analysis first, and choose an area with convenient transportation and clear supervision; pay attention to operational capabilities, including channel management, repair and maintenance, and customer service; and rationally set up funds and insurance arrangements to deal with unexpected maintenance and legal compliance costs.

summary: the reasons for investing in thai aircraft rooms include tourist traffic, differentiated attractiveness and diversified income models, but there are also legal and operational risks. it is recommended that investors follow the principles of prudence and data drive, conduct compliance consultation and operational planning, and gradually expand allocations after piloting.
